Applications

3.1
Use in systems with isolated transformer neutral point
(IT systems)
3.1.1

General

IT systems are predominantly used in consumer installations with stringent requirements
with respect to power supply availability. Circuits are generally only interrupted if two
insulation faults occur simultaneously in different phases.
The IT network type is the preferred choice in the following areas, for example:
• Buildings with rooms used for medical purposes
• Chemical industry
• Mineral oil industry
• Steel industry
• Mining
The IT system is a low-voltage system for supplying electrical power with increased fail-
safety in the event of ground faults. It is operated without connection of the live
conductors to ground. The 3WA circuit breaker is the perfect solution for protecting
these systems.
A ground fault does not result in system shutdown and the system can continue to
operate. The standard IEC 60364-4-41 (VDE 0100-410) therefore requires insulation
monitoring to indicate a fault of this kind. In the unusual event that a fault on the load
side coincides with a second fault on the infeed side, the full line-to-line voltage is
connected across one contact of the circuit breaker.
For this reason, the 3WA circuit breakers are tested up to a maximum voltage of 690 V
AC in accordance with standard IEC / DIN EN 60947-2 Annex H and are suitable for use
in IT systems.
